Even with the appropriate security measures in plan, there is still the risk that an instance of malware can go undetected by your anti-virus software or even disable it. The Malicious Software Removal Tool is designed for such situations. When the tool is run, it detects and removes any malicious software it finds on your computer.

If you are running Windows XP, there are two ways that you can take advantage of the Malicious Software Removal Tool. The first way is to have Windows Update manage it for you. It will automatically download the Malicious Software Removal Tool once a month as part of your updates. The tool will scan your computer and subsequently delete itself.

The second option is to manually download the tool. The advantage to this is that you can run it more frequently than once a month and at your own leisure.

To manually install the software:

  1. Visit the Malicious Software Removal Tool page in the Download Center.
  2. Click the Download button.
  3. Click Save and navigate to the location where you want to save the file.
  4. Locate and double click Windows-KB890830-V1.30.exe.
  5. Follow the on-screen instructions.

Once the installation is complete, you can launch the Malicious Software Removal Tools and begin scanning your computer.
